Safety
DIY furnace repair is especially detrimental to your personal safety. Not only could you hurt yourself in the process of repairs, but you could likely cause leaks or further damage to your system that could modify the comfort or safety of your residence. Professionals are trained to repair furnaces safely and properly.
Costly
While many think that DIY repair reduces costs, in many cases it can end up costing homeowners additional money when attempted repairs go wrong. There are often times precise tools that are necessary to make specific furnace repairs, and when homeowners do not have the proper materials, they could be producing more work for the professional when they are ultimately called.
